It is so important to have you're own domain name and Web site. Especially if you are thinking of building a brand or e-commerce. In this episode, I am going to give you very good reasons why you need to do this and not use a third party as you're home on the Web.

Show Notes:

– It will always be there for as long as you keep it alive.
– You get to control how it looks and all other aspects of the site.
– You are free to change your mind at any time and take it in another direction.
– You are not relying on a service that might go paid or disappear at some point. For example, many of the social networks that now no longer exist.
– You are not dependent on a third party company and their privacy rules and how they use your data.
– Users know exactly where to find you.
– You can use the site and domain as a jumping point to anywhere else you want to direct people.
– You can use services to see metrics and learn from your users what is working and what is not. This is invaluable data.
– You can gather user information via forms and/or emails and start a two-way conversation.
– If you decide to sell goods or services, you are free to implement that the way you want it to be.
– You are not forced to display advertising or other distractions based on the desires of another company.
– You get to provide the experience to visitors and potential customers exactly the way you want it to be.
